The Miami Dolphins made it official, announcing their deal with free agent linebacker Karlos Dansby.
Dansby's five-year contract is worth $43 million, including $22 million in guaranteed money.
The 6-foot-4, 250-pounder spent the previous six seasons with the Arizona Cardinals.
Originally, a second-round pick in the 2004 draft from Auburn, the linebacker accumulated 563 tackles, 25 1/2 sacks, 25 passes defensed, 12 forced fumbles and 10 interceptions with Arizona.
